/cx/bbu test [quiet]

This command starts the battery capacity test. The test may take up to 24 hours to complete. During the test, the BBU is not capable of backup operation and the write cache of all units attached to that controller is disabled. Once the test is completed with no error and the BBU status returns to OK, the write cache will be re-enabled.

Note: Once started, the test can not be terminated before it completes. Write cache cannot be enabled until the test completes.

AEN (Asynchronous Event Notification) messages are also generated by controllers to notify the user of the command status.

Check for AENs with the alarms command /cx show alarms [reverse]. Using the “reverse” attribute displays the most recent AEN message at the bottom of the list. (For a list of all AENs, see the user guide that came with your 3ware RAID controller.)

/cx/bbu enable

This command enables BBU detection on the controller. If the BBU is Ready, the controller will utilize BBU functionality in the event of a power failure.

/cx/bbu disable [quiet]

This command disables BBU detection on the controller. When disabled, the controller ignores the existence of the BBU and will show no BBU is installed even if a BBU is physically attached.
